Output 38f8b54ec587eb5d989c00b036b4bee32ec7c524a0535b195aa95bfeb4eaba6d:30

value
31795340
script pubkey
OP_0 OP_PUSHBYTES_20 85ec6424022acd3744f8b46752f4bf2d49e5c52e
address
ltc1qshkxgfqz9txnw38ck3n49a9l94y7t3fw7w0akw
transaction
38f8b54ec587eb5d989c00b036b4bee32ec7c524a0535b195aa95bfeb4eaba6d
spent
true